Write the equilibrium expressions for each of the following equilibria:

a. 2 Ba + O2 ⇌ 2 BaO
b. 2 Mg + O2 ⇌ 2MgO
c. P4 + 5 O2 ⇌ P4O10

In this case, since the equilibrium expression is set up by dividing the products over the reactants and powering to the stoichiometric coefficient, we can proceed as follows:

a. 2 Ba + O2 ⇌ 2 BaO.


K=([BaO]^2)/([Ba]^2[O_2])

b. 2 Mg + O2 ⇌ 2MgO


K=([MgO]^2)/([Mg]^2[O_2])

c. P4 + 5 O2 ⇌ P4O10


K=([P_4O_(10)]^2)/([P_4][O_2]^5)
